Social Media Marketing for the Future: 5 Bold Predictions

The world of social media is constantly evolving and changing, and this trend is showing no signs of slowing down. As more and more people turn to social media for their daily dose of information, entertainment, and communication, businesses are also realizing the importance of having a strong presence on these platforms. In fact, social media marketing is quickly becoming the go-to strategy for businesses to reach their target audiences and stay competitive in the fast-paced digital landscape.

1. Personalization is the Key

With the huge amount of data available on social media platforms, businesses now have the opportunity to personalize their marketing efforts like never before. This means tailoring their content and campaigns to specific demographics, interests, and behaviors of their target audience. By utilizing social media analytics and insights, businesses can gain a deeper understanding of their customers and deliver more relevant and personalized content, leading to higher engagement and conversions.

2. Video is Here to Stay

It’s no secret that video has become the most consumed type of content on social media platforms. From short-form clips on platforms like TikTok and Instagram Reels to longer videos on YouTube and Facebook, video content is dominating the social media landscape. As we move into the future, businesses will need to focus on creating compelling and engaging video content to capture the attention of their audience and stand out from the competition.

3. The Rise of Social Commerce

Social media platforms have already integrated e-commerce features, allowing businesses to directly sell their products and services to their followers. This trend is expected to continue and even grow in the future, making social media a powerful tool for generating sales and revenue. As more consumers turn to social media for shopping inspiration and recommendations, businesses that have a strong social commerce strategy in place will have a significant advantage.

4. Quality over Quantity

In the past, having a large number of followers on social media was often considered a measure of success for businesses. However, with constant algorithm changes and the rise of fake followers and engagement, the focus is shifting towards quality over quantity. Businesses need to build a genuine and engaged community of followers who are interested in their brand and offerings. This can be achieved by creating valuable and meaningful content that resonates with their audience.

5.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Chatbots

AI has been making waves in the world of social media marketing, and its role is expected to become even more significant in the future. With the help of AI, businesses can analyze vast amounts of data and automate tasks such as content creation, customer service, and ad targeting. Chatbots, in particular, are becoming a popular tool for businesses to improve their customer service and engagement on social media platforms.

Social Media Marketing Trends for 2024

Social media has become an integral part of our daily lives and has dramatically changed the way we communicate, consume information, and do business. As we look towards the future, it is important to stay up-to-date with the latest social media marketing trends to effectively reach and engage with your target audience. In this article, we will explore the top social media marketing trends for 2024 and how you can leverage them for your brand’s success.

1. The Rise of Influencer Marketing

Influencer marketing has been on the rise in recent years, and this trend is expected to continue in 2024. As brands focus on creating authentic and relatable content, collaborating with influencers has become a popular strategy. These influencers have built a loyal following and can help brands reach their target audience in a more organic and effective way. To make the most of this trend, brands should carefully select influencers who align with their values and have engaged followers.

2. Growth of Video Content

Video content has taken over social media platforms in recent years, and this trend is only going to grow in the coming years. With the rise of platforms like TikTok and Instagram Reels, short-form video content has become more popular and engaging. Brands should consider investing in video content creation to increase brand awareness and engagement with their audience. This can include behind-the-scenes footage, product demonstrations, or even user-generated content.

3. Social Commerce on the Rise

Social media has become a powerful tool for e-commerce, and this trend is set to become even more prevalent in 2024. With the integration of shopping features on platforms like Facebook and Instagram, brands can now directly sell products to their followers. This makes it easier for customers to discover and purchase products without leaving the platform. To stay ahead of the game, brands should optimize their social media profiles for e-commerce and create visually appealing and shoppable content.

4. Personalization and Customer Experience

Consumers today are looking for a more personalized and meaningful experience from brands, and this trend is expected to continue in 2024. Brands should focus on creating personalized content for their target audience and providing a seamless customer experience. This can include tailoring content based on a user’s location, interests, purchase history, and more. This will not only improve customer satisfaction but also increase the chances of converting followers into customers.

5. The Role of Augmented Reality

Augmented reality (AR) has been gaining popularity on social media, and this trend is only going to grow in the future. AR allows brands to create interactive and immersive experiences for their audience, making it a powerful tool for marketing. Brands can use AR to showcase products, provide virtual try-on experiences, and even create branded AR filters for users to use on social media platforms. This not only creates a unique experience for users but also increases brand awareness and engagement.

How to use Social Media Marketing to Reach Gen Z

Gen Z, the generation born between 1997 and 2012, has emerged as a significant consumer group with immense purchasing power. Growing up in the digital age, Gen Zers are tech-savvy and highly influenced by social media platforms. In fact, according to a survey by Adweek, 98% of Gen Zers own a smartphone and spend an average of 11 hours a week on social media. As a business, if you want to tap into this market and reach Gen Z, you need to have a strong social media marketing strategy. In this article, we will discuss how you can effectively use social media marketing to reach the Gen Z audience.

Understand the Platform Preferences of Gen Z

The first step to reaching Gen Z through social media marketing is to understand their platform preferences. While Facebook may have been the go-to platform for a long time, Gen Zers are now more likely to be found on Instagram, Snapchat, and TikTok. These platforms provide a more visually appealing and interactive experience, which is what Gen Zers crave. Therefore, it is essential to have a presence on these platforms and tailor your content accordingly.

Be Authentic and Relatable

Gen Zers are a highly diverse group, and they value authenticity and relatability. They are not easily swayed by traditional advertisements and can see through inauthentic marketing tactics. So, it is crucial to have a genuine voice and a relatable brand image on social media to capture their attention. Engage with your audience understand their interests, and create content that resonates with them. This will help you establish a strong connection with Gen Zers and build trust, ultimately leading to brand loyalty.

Leverage User-Generated Content

User-generated content is a powerful tool in social media marketing, especially when trying to reach Gen Z. 61% of Gen Zers trust user-generated content more than brand-created content. This means that user-generated content has a higher chance of influencing their purchasing decisions. Encourage your customers to share their experiences with your brand on social media and showcase this content on your platforms. This not only validates your brand but also reaches a wider audience through the followers of those who have shared their content.

Incorporate Influencer Marketing

Influencer marketing has been on the rise in recent years, and it is a tactic that works exceptionally well with Gen Z. Influencers are people who have a significant presence on social media, with a loyal following. They are seen as relatable and trustworthy, making them an excellent way to reach Gen Z. Collaborate with influencers that align with your brand values and have a similar target audience. This partnership will not only help you reach their followers but also lend credibility to your brand.

Utilize New Features and Trends

Gen Zers are always looking for something new and exciting, and social media platforms are constantly evolving. This makes it essential for businesses to stay up-to-date with the latest features and trends on social media. For example, Instagram Reels has gained tremendous popularity among Gen Zers, so it would be wise to incorporate this feature into your social media strategy. This will not only help you stay relevant but also showcase your brand’s creativity and adaptability.

Social Media Marketing Tips for Small Businesses

Social media marketing is an essential tool for small businesses. It can help you reach a wider audience, build brand awareness, and generate leads. However, social media marketing can be overwhelming, especially if you don’t have a lot of experience.

Here are some tips for growing a small business in social media marketing

  • Define your goals: What do you want to achieve with your social media marketing? Do you want to increase brand awareness, generate leads, or drive sales? Once you know your goals, you can start to develop a strategy to achieve them.
  • Identify your target audience: Who are you trying to reach with your social media marketing? Once you know your target audience, you can tailor your content to their interests.
  • Choose the right platforms: Not all social media platforms are created equal. Some platforms, like Facebook and Twitter, are great for reaching a wide audience. Others, like Instagram and Pinterest, are more visual and can be used to showcase your products or services.
  • Create high-quality content: Your social media content should be interesting, informative, and engaging. Make sure your content is relevant to your target audience and that it aligns with your overall brand.
  • Be consistent: Consistency is key to successful social media marketing. You should post content regularly, but not too often. A good rule of thumb is to post 2-3 times per week.
  • Engage with your audience: It’s not enough to just post content and then walk away. You need to engage with your audience by responding to comments, asking questions, and participating in conversations.
  • Use social media analytics: Social media analytics can help you track the performance of your social media campaigns. This information can be used to improve your future campaigns.
  • Use paid advertising: If you want to reach a wider audience, you can use paid advertising on social media. Paid advertising can be a great way to generate leads and drive sales.
  • Be patient: Social media marketing takes time. It takes time to build an audience and to start seeing results. Don’t get discouraged if you don’t see results overnight.

How to Create a Social Media Marketing Strategy

Creating a social media marketing strategy is essential for any business looking to build brand awareness, engage with customers, and drive sales. A well-crafted strategy allows businesses to effectively communicate their message, reach their target audience, and achieve their marketing goals.

Here are the key steps to creating an effective social media marketing strategy:

Define Your Goals: The first step in creating a social media marketing strategy is to identify your objectives. What do you want to achieve through your social media efforts? Some common goals include increasing brand awareness, driving sales, and building customer loyalty.

Understand Your Target Audience: Understanding your target audience is crucial for effective social media marketing. Conduct market research to identify your audience’s demographics, interests, and behaviors. This will help you determine the best platforms to reach them and the type of content that will resonate with them.

Choose the Right Platforms: With an understanding of your target audience, you can determine which social media platforms they use most frequently. Focus your efforts on the platforms where your audience is most active.

Develop a Content Strategy: Content is the backbone of any social media strategy. Decide on the type of content you want to post, such as photos, videos, or blog posts, and create a content calendar to ensure consistent posting.

Engage with Your Audience: Social media is not just about broadcasting your message; it’s about joining and participating in conversations. Engage with your audience by responding to comments and messages, asking questions, and running polls or contests.

Monitor and Analyze Your Results: Regularly monitor your social media efforts to see how your strategy is performing. Use analytics tools to measure engagement, reach, and conversions. This data can help you make informed decisions and adjust your strategy as needed.

Stay Informed: Social media is ever-evolving, so it’s essential to stay informed about new trends, algorithm changes, and platform updates. This will help you adapt your strategy and stay ahead of the competition.

Social Media Marketing Tools for Business

Social media marketing tools have become essential for businesses looking to enhance their online presence and engage with their target audience effectively. These tools offer a range of functionalities, from scheduling posts and managing multiple social media accounts to tracking analytics and automating advertising campaigns. Popular options like Hootsuite, Buffer, and Sprout Social help streamline content management, allowing businesses to maintain a consistent online presence across various platforms.

Moreover, tools like Facebook Ads Manager and Google Ads make it easier to create and optimize paid social media campaigns, ensuring that businesses can efficiently reach their desired audience and maximize their marketing efforts. By utilizing these social media marketing tools, businesses can boost their online visibility, drive engagement, and ultimately achieve their marketing goals.

Best Social Media Platforms for Marketing

Social media has become an essential tool for businesses of all sizes. It provides a platform to connect with potential and current customers, build brand awareness, and drive sales. However, with so many social media platforms available, it can be difficult to know which ones are right for your business.

In this article, we will discuss the best social media platforms for marketing and help you choose the right ones for your business.

Facebook

Facebook is the most popular social media platform in the world, with over 2.91 billion monthly active users. This makes it a great place to reach a large audience of potential customers. Facebook also offers a variety of advertising tools that can help you target your ads to specific demographics.

Instagram

Instagram is a visual platform that is perfect for businesses that want to share photos and videos of their products or services. Instagram has over 2 billion monthly active users, and it is especially popular among younger demographics.

YouTube

YouTube is the second most popular website in the world, and it is the go-to platform for watching videos. If you create high-quality videos that are relevant to your target audience, YouTube can be a great way to reach new customers and generate leads.

LinkedIn

LinkedIn is a professional networking site that is ideal for businesses that want to connect with other businesses and professionals. LinkedIn has over 830 million monthly active users, and it is a great place to share your company’s expertise and build relationships.

Twitter

Twitter is a microblogging platform that is perfect for businesses that want to share short bursts of information. Twitter has over 330 million monthly active users, and it is a great place to keep up with industry news and trends.

Pinterest

Pinterest is a visual discovery engine that is perfect for businesses that want to showcase their products or services. Pinterest has over 433 million monthly active users, and it is a great place to drive traffic to your website.

TikTok

TikTok is a video-sharing social networking service that is popular among younger demographics. TikTok has over 1 billion daily active users, and it is a great way to reach a new audience and generate excitement about your brand.

Snapchat

Snapchat is a photo and video messaging app that is popular among younger demographics. Snapchat has over 330 million daily active users, and it is a great way to reach a new audience and share behind-the-scenes content.

How to Measure the Success of Social Media Marketing Campaigns

Social media marketing is a powerful tool that can help businesses reach a wider audience, build brand awareness, and generate leads. However, it’s important to measure the success of your social media campaigns so that you can make sure you’re getting the most out of your investment.

Step 1: Define Your Goals

The first step to measuring the success of your social media marketing campaigns is to define your goals. What do you want to achieve with your social media marketing? Do you want to increase brand awareness? Generate leads? Drive traffic to your website? Once you know your goals, you can start to track the metrics that matter most to you.

Step 2: Choose the Right Metrics

There are a number of different metrics that you can track to measure the success of your social media marketing campaigns. Some of the most common metrics include:

  • Engagement: This metric tracks the level of interaction that your content is receiving. This can include likes, comments, shares, and retweets.
  • Reach: This metric tracks the number of people who have seen your content.
  • Lead Generation: This metric tracks the number of leads that you have generated from your social media marketing.
  • Sales: This metric tracks the amount of sales that you have generated from your social media marketing.

Step 3: Measure Your Campaign Results

Once you have chosen the metrics that you want to track, you can start to measure your campaign results. You can use a variety of tools to do this, such as Google Analytics, SproutSocial, and Hootsuite.

Step 4: Monitor, Analyze, and Report

It’s important to monitor your social media campaign results on a regular basis. This will help you to identify what’s working well and what’s not. You can then use this information to make adjustments to your campaigns.

Step 5: Refine and Repeat

Once you have a good understanding of what’s working well and what’s not, you can start to refine your social media marketing campaigns. This may involve creating new content, targeting a different audience, or using different social media platforms.

Social Media Marketing for e-Commerce Business

Social media is a powerful tool that can be used to reach a large audience and drive sales for e-commerce businesses. In fact, a recent study by Statista found that 77% of internet users worldwide use social media, and 55% of them use it to research products before making a purchase.

There are a number of different social media platforms that can be used for e-commerce marketing, but the best ones for your business will depend on your target audience and products.

Some of the most popular platforms for e-commerce businesses include:

Facebook: Facebook has a massive user base of over 2.9 billion people, making it a great platform for reaching a wide audience. You can use Facebook to create a business page, share product photos and videos, run ads, and engage with customers.

Instagram: Instagram is a visually-driven platform, making it perfect for showcasing your products. You can use Instagram to share product photos, videos, and stories. You can also run ads on Instagram to target a specific audience.

Pinterest: Pinterest is a great platform for sharing product ideas and inspiration. You can create Pinterest boards to showcase your products, and you can also run ads on Pinterest to target a specific audience.

Twitter: Twitter is a great platform for sharing news and updates about your business. You can also use Twitter to connect with customers and influencers.

FAQs

What is social media marketing and how is it beneficial for businesses?

Social media marketing is the use of social media platforms to promote a product or service. It is increasingly popular as it allows businesses to reach a large and targeted audience at a low cost. It also enables them to engage and build relationships with potential customers, increase brand awareness, and drive sales.

How is social media marketing evolving in the future?

As social media platforms continue to update and introduce new features, social media marketing is also evolving. In the future, we can expect to see more live streaming, personalized content, and the use of artificial intelligence and chatbots for customer service. Social commerce, where customers can make purchases directly through social media, is also expected to grow.

What are the key considerations for businesses when implementing a social media marketing strategy?

A successful social media marketing strategy requires careful planning and execution. Businesses need to identify their target audience and choose the right social media platforms to reach them. They also need to create engaging and shareable content, be consistent with their brand messaging and tone, and monitor and analyze their performance to continually improve.

How can businesses use influencers for social media marketing?

Influencer marketing is a growing trend in social media marketing. By collaborating with influencers who have a large and engaged following, businesses can reach a larger and more targeted audience and build trust with potential customers. It is important for businesses to choose influencers who align with their brand and have a genuine connection with their followers.

What are some potential challenges of social media marketing for businesses?

While social media marketing offers many benefits, there are also potential challenges for businesses. These include maintaining a consistent brand image across multiple platforms, keeping up with changing algorithms and trends, handling negative feedback or comments, and measuring ROI. Businesses need to have a solid plan in place to address these challenges and stay adaptable.

Is social media marketing suitable for all types of businesses?

While social media marketing can be beneficial for most businesses, it may not be the best fit for every industry or niche. Some products or services may not have a large enough online audience or may not be suitable for visual platforms. It is crucial for businesses to research their target audience and industry trends before investing in social media marketing to determine if it is the most effective strategy for their business.
